Description of πŸ’‘ Seasonic S12III 650 SSR-650GB3 650W 80+ Bronze ATX12V & EPS12V Power Supply with Smart & Silent Fan Control

Fixed cabling - Provides all the necessary cables required for a standard pc. 80 plus Bronze - 82% efficient at 20% load, 85% efficient at 50% load, and 82% efficient at 100% load. 120 mm SLEEVE BEARING FAN; The 120 mm fan inside is regulated by the Sea sonic S2FC fan control, which optimizes the fan speed according to the needs of the system to create a quiet and pleasant environment. 5 year warranty ; Our commitment to superior quality.

Skip this PSU

Bought a Seasonic S12III 650 SSR-650GB. The power supply worked perfectly for about 24 hours, after which problems arose. I'm building this computer for a colleague and his skeptical wife. First they reported that the computer keeps freezing, which (at first) could be anything. The computer kept shutting down and eventually wouldn't turn back on. I replaced the PSU with a new one (not Seasonic from Revain) and bam everything worked fine. I removed the cover and found the transformer was cracked

Disappointing defect

I love Seasonic products so this review is difficult to write. This unit was built for a friend and then returned to Revane. This PSU had coil whine when the computer was off. Once the machine was turned on, the howl was replaced by the sound of an arc/hum. I ruled out the PSU fan as the cause and then ruled out power line noise by connecting this PSU to an active PFC UPS.
